检索规则说明:AND代表“并且”;OR代表“或者”;NOT代表“不包含”;(注意必须大写,运算符两边需空一格)
检 索 范 例 :范例一: (K=图书馆学 OR K=情报学) AND A=范并思 范例二:J=计算机应用与软件 AND (U=C++ OR U=Basic) NOT M=Visual
作 者:刘源杨[1,2] 马建辉[1,2] 王知学[1,2] 王岗[1,2]
机构地区:[1]山东省汽车电子重点实验室,山东济南250014 [2]山东省科学院自动化研究所,山东济南250014
出 处:《电子设计工程》2013年第14期154-155,共2页Electronic Design Engineering
摘 要:为了定位嵌入式设备当前运行软件的版本,设计了一种获取嵌入式软件版本信息的方法,首先设计电路实现按键检测和LED驱动复用IO脚,当IO脚为输入方向时,通过IO状态的读取可以检测按键的按下和弹起状态,当IO脚为输出方向时,可以设置高低电平实现LED的亮灭控制。具体应用时,首先设置IO脚为输入方向,周期检测按键操作,检测到有效的按键按下操作后,当按键弹起时将IO脚设置为输出方向,以PWM的方式驱动LED,通过不同的闪烁频率、间歇时间和闪烁次数进行软件版本的显示。In order to locate software version on running embedded device,designed a method to extract embedded software version information.First design a circuit multiplex key detection and LED driver on single IO pin,when the IO pin is the input direction,can detect the state of the button press and bounce through the IO state read,when the IO pin is the output direction,can set high and low to achieve LED control.In specific application,first set the IO pin to input direction,detect key operation cyclely,when detects a valid key press operation,after the key is released,set the IO pin to output direction,drive LED in PWM way,display software version by different blink frequency,intermittent time and number of flashes.
分 类 号:TP311[自动化与计算机技术—计算机软件与理论]
正在载入数据...
正在载入数据...
正在载入数据...
正在载入数据...
正在载入数据...
正在载入数据...
正在载入数据...
正在链接到云南高校图书馆文献保障联盟下载...
云南高校图书馆联盟文献共享服务平台 版权所有©
您的IP:216.73.216.3